About the Role

Veeam VDC Security Engineering builds and operates the security platform for a multi-cloud (Azure and AWS) SaaS serving regulated industries. This role sits in Platform Security and helps drive AI/LLM security as a discipline. You will help shape how VDC uses large language models safely (defensively, at scale) and how we use them offensively to find and fix real security defects faster than traditional programs allow.
What You'll Do
  • Design and ship the data-handling controls (code, filters, and infrastructure guardrails) for VDC's internal AI tooling and the AI features in our product. Redact sensitive data from prompts, model context, logs, and outputs before any of it reaches a third-party model provider
  • Build and productionize an AI-enhanced vulnerability reduction capability that plugs into CI/CD, surfaces real defects with a low false-positive rate, and either recommends or applies remediation without eroding developer trust
  • Publish and evolve a self-serve secure-LLM-use pattern for other VDC engineering teams, including input filtering, output validation, provider-tier data classification, and threat-model shortcuts for teams adding AI features to their products
  • Threat-model internal AI tools for prompt injection, indirect prompt attack surfaces, model exfiltration, and agent-tool boundary weaknesses. Partner with the red team on findings, then build the fixes and guardrails with tool owners
  • Partner with Compliance to shape auditor-facing evidence for AI-assisted controls, including which evidence formats hold up when the collector was an LLM and where human review must gate disclosure
  • Contribute the AI-security lens to adjacent Security Engineering programs where LLMs touch the surface area: vulnerability management maturity, supply chain risk reduction, code owners routing, and compliance evidence collection
  • Set VDC's direction on emerging LLM security tools and internal AI-forward workflows: what to adopt, what to skip, and what to build in-house

What You'll Bring
  • 10+ years across security and engineering, with recent focus on AI/ML systems in production (LLM deployments, model risk, or AI-driven security tooling)
  • Hands-on experience shipping controls (Code, infra or data gaurdrails) that operate on LLM inputs and outputs (redaction, filtering, output validation, prompt-injection defense)
  • Build and tune detection systems that catch PII and secrets (API keys, credentials, personal data) across large, messy datasets, knowing when a regex rule is good enough, when you need a trained classifier, and when only an LLM can catch it, and justifying that choice on cost, latency, and accuracy grounds
  • Track record of taking AI/security work from concept to production, including designing for developer trust and false-positive management
  • Strong cloud security fundamentals across Azure and AWS: RBAC, secret management, key handling, network egress controls
  • Turn ad-hoc "is this LLM use case safe?" questions into a reusable mechanism (a scoring rubric in PR templates, a lint rule, an approval gate) that teams run themselves, instead of a doc they read once or a person they ping
  • Comfort building and hardening security tooling in Python and Go
  • Familiarity with regulated-industry evidentiary expectations (SOC 2 Type 2, ISO 27001, FedRAMP, HITRUST) and how AI-generated evidence intersects with them
  • Hands-on experience with agentic AI development environments (Claude Code, Cursor, GitHub Copilot Enterprise) and their operational security implications
  • A demonstrable track record of shipping production code (a code portfolio, open-source contributions, or internal build history). This is a hands-on building role, not an advisory one

About Veeam Software

Veeam Software is a privately held information technology company that develops backup, disaster recovery and intelligent data management software for virtual, physical and multi-cloud infrastructures. The company's headquarters are in Baar, Switzerland, and it has offices in more than 30 countries. Veeam has more than 375,000 customers worldwide, including 82% of the Fortune 500 and 69% of the Global 2,000 enterprises. The company was founded in 2006 by Ratmir Timashev and Andrei Baronov.
